More Sausages get ‘UnWrapped’ for Rogen Flick
TheWrap is reporting that the cast for Seth Rogen’s upcoming R-rated animated comedy flick Sausage Party due out next year is starting to fill out and the cast is rather impressive and features a number of voice over heavy weights.
Sausage Party will feature Seth Rogen, James Franco, Jonah Hill, Michael Cera and David Krumholtz. Also according to the article:
Rogen and Evan Goldberg wrote the script with Kyle Hunter and Ariel Shaffir.
Annapurna’s Megan Ellison will produce with Rogen and Goldberg’s Point Grey Pictures, as well as Vernon. Point Grey’s James Weaver will executive produce with Hill, Hunter and Shaffir.
“Sausage Party” follows one heroic piece of meat’s quest to discover the truth about his existence. After falling out of a shopping cart, the sausage protagonist teams up with some new friends to embark on a perilous journey through the supermarket and return to their aisles before the Fourth of July sale.
Sausage Party comes out next year through Sony in theaters everywhere.
